Critical Illness insurance Vs Medical Insurance 

You may already have a health insurance policy in place to reimburse your medical expenses and cover your hospitalization costs. However, critical illness insurance offers a benefits plan that pays you a lumpsum amount as soon as you are diagnosed with a critical illness that is covered in your insurance policy.

In a regular medical insurance plan, the sum insured is not that huge, and they only pay for expenses incurred during hospitalization. Critical illness, on the other hand, pays a much higher sum insured to help you pay for every treatmentrelated expense incurred due to your illness. A critical illness cover is specifically designed to help you with not just medical bills but also the cost of medical tests and loss of pay due to non-productive days. But most importantly, your health insurance policy may or may not cover critical illness. However, critical illness insurance will certainly provide you with a comprehensive cover for all the conditions covered in its policy document.

Also, regular medical insurance policies may attract a higher premium because it covers a broader scope of events. As a result, the premium charged is also higher. On the other hand, critical illness insurance covers only a set of life-threatening illnesses. If you are diagnosed with any one of the covered illnesses, then the entire sum assured is released to you as a lumpsum payout. There is no saying how useful this amount can be at such a testing phase in your life. Critical illness cover gives you higher coverage at a lower premium.

A regular health insurance plan includes hospitalization due to an accident or a medical illness. The cover only pays for pre and posthospitalization expensesCritical illness insurance, on the other hand, covers events that fall outside the purview of a regular health plan. Don’t forget to factor in costs like travel, loss of income, boarding, and postoperative care when you are suffering from a critical disease! These funds can be used for all that and more, including the lifestyle change that is required to prevent such illnesses in the future.  

Benefits of Critical Illness Cover

The number of critical illnesses covered in the medical insurance policy may vary from insurer to insurer. Some of the common ones include cancer, organ transplant, heart disease, and kidney failure, to name a few. You can choose the coverage amount as per the premium you can afford. Here are some of the benefits of critical illness insurance:  

  • Protects your savings: Your treatment will not have any impact on your savings as the cover will take care of all the expenses.  
  • Ensures quick medical treatment: Due to the fast claim process, your treatment can begin quickly without worrying about the money.  
  • No medical check-ups: Does not require medical check-ups before purchase.  
  • Tax Saving: Under Section 80D of the Income Tax Department, you can claim tax benefits up to Rs. 50,000.
